The High Energy Ball Mill Emax combines highfrequency impact, intensive friction, and controlled circular jar movements to a unique and highly effective size reduction mechanism. The grinding jars have an oval shape and are mounted on two discs respectively which move the jars on a circular course without changing their orientation.

For all nanocrystalline materials prepared by highenergy ball milling synthesis route, surface and interface contamination is a major concern. In particular, mechanical attributed contamination by the milling tools (Fe or WC) as well as ambient gas (trace impurities such as O 2, N 2 in rare gases) can be problems for highenergy ball milling ...
